Suggest an update Name* Categories* State* Locality* ZIP* Street address* Phone* Website* Company description* Visit the hotel Stir Crazy, which is in the state Florida (FL), city Estero. Our hotel can be found at 23106 Fashion Dr, Ste 135, Estero, FL 33928-2525. Great deals on best and cheap hotels. Your comments* (not for publishing) * — Required information Stir Crazy/23106 Fashion Dr - Estero - Florida (FL) ← View details 23106 Fashion Dr, Ste 135, Estero, FL 33928-2525, Estero, Florida (FL) +1 239-498-6430